Find the principal needed now to get the given amount; that is, find the present value,To get $120 after 3 1/4 years at 9% compounded continuouslyThe present value of $120 is $(Round to the nearest cent as needed.)

\$89.57

1) Considering the given data, let's turn that mixed number into a decimal form. 3 1/4 is the same as 3.25.

2) Now, we can plug all the data we were told.


\begin{gathered} 120=P_0e^(0.09*3.25) \\ Pe^(0.09* \:3.25)=120 \\ (Pe^(0.09* \:3.25))/(e^(0.2925))=(120)/(e^(0.2925)) \\ P=(120)/(e^(0.2925)) \\ P=89.56742\approx89.57 \end{gathered}

Note that we had to round it off to the nearest cent as requested.
